YNM Safety is a leading metal beam crash barriers manufacturer in India, producing longitudinal highway guardrail and crash barrier systems that protect medians, shoulders, bridges, and high-risk curves from run-off-road collisions. When engineers and contractors search for metal beam crash barriers manufacturers or reliable crash barriers for expressways, they need a partner who can align posts, rails, transitions, and coatings with IRC 119, MoRTH 803, EN 1317, and project-specific drawings—without treating barriers as a commodity part list.

Our metal beam crash barrier range includes W beam crash barriers (the most widely deployed profile), thrie beam crash barriers for higher containment, double W beam crash barriers for demanding medians and bridge approaches, and roller beam crash barriers for selected geometric hazards. Each family is manufactured with controlled roll-forming, hot-dip galvanizing, and inspection suitable for national highway packages, state PWD corridors, urban expressways, and export consignments.

Manufacturing Process of Metal Beam Crash Barriers

Our metal beam crash barrier systems are manufactured through a controlled, quality-driven process to ensure strength, coating integrity, and compliance with national and international road safety standards.

01

Raw Material Procurement & Inspection

High-quality steel coils are sourced from certified suppliers. Each batch undergoes chemical and mechanical testing to ensure conformity with IS, ASTM, and MoRTH specifications.

02

Steel Coil Slitting & Cutting

Steel coils are precision-slit and cut into required widths and lengths based on W-Beam, Thrie-Beam, or Double W-Beam specifications to maintain dimensional accuracy.

03

Cold Roll Forming

The cut steel sheets are passed through advanced roll-forming machines to achieve the exact crash barrier profile with uniform thickness and consistent geometry.

04

Punching & Slot Formation

Computer-controlled punching machines create bolt holes and slots with high precision to ensure easy installation and perfect alignment at site.

05

End Finishing & Edge Trimming

Barrier ends are trimmed, deburred, and finished to eliminate sharp edges, improving safety during handling and installation.

06

Surface Preparation (Degreasing & Pickling)

Formed beams are thoroughly cleaned through degreasing and pickling processes to remove oil, rust, and impurities, ensuring superior coating adhesion.

07

Hot-Dip Galvanizing

The beams are hot-dip galvanized as per IS 4759 / ASTM A123 standards, providing a uniform zinc coating for long-term corrosion resistance in harsh environments.

08

Quality Testing & Inspection

Finished barriers undergo strict quality checks, including coating thickness, dimensional accuracy, mechanical strength, and visual inspection before approval.

09

Packing, Storage & Dispatch

Approved crash barriers are securely bundled, labeled, and stored in covered areas. Products are then dispatched with proper documentation to ensure safe and timely delivery.

Quality Standards

Compliance with national and international road safety standards

MoRTH 803

Ministry of Road Transport & Highways Section 803 Specifications

ISO 9001:2015

Quality Management System Certification

EN 1317

European Standard for Road Restraint Systems

IRC 119

Indian Roads Congress Guidelines for Traffic Safety Barriers
